The Gunners started in ferocious fashion against Spurs, moving the ball around swiftly and getting into dangerous positions early on. However, Spurs saw off the Gunners offence and responded back admirably by taking it to Arsene Wenger’s side and eventually went ahead after Harry Kane snuck in behind Laurent Koscielny and Per Mertesacker to put the visitors 1-0 up. Hate to say it but Spurs were the better side in the first 45, but Arsenal were not ticking.

Arsenal did however manage to bag and equaliser thanks to Gibbs and a lovely looping ball from Mesut Ozil in the 77th minute which set the game up nicely for a frantic finish, which is what we got.

But the points were shared and Arsenal fans will feel a lot happier that they came away from the game with something rather than nothing.

The draw leaves them sitting in second place in the table with 26 points, behind Manchester City only on goal difference.
